North American Grain and Oilseed Review: Dwindling supplies underpin increases

U.S. soybeans, wheat pull back

Reading Time: 3 minutes By Glen Hallick, MarketsFarm Glacier Farm Media MarketsFarm – Intercontinental Exchange canola futures closed higher on Monday due to tighter supplies. Statistics Canada reported canola stocks at the end of 2024 were about 19 per cent smaller than those the year before.
